Output 08ba8be2f304c9472650c14cdb7e67040af38a307c6d2aabe8993b4e4df5c593:109

value
25500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c199c0de46b482ae987d330eda19f6487d505da OP_EQUAL
address
3QfztGdbrxk5zN5v27xyyiBKdgmq4xsAbF
transaction
08ba8be2f304c9472650c14cdb7e67040af38a307c6d2aabe8993b4e4df5c593
confirmations
515476
spent
true